Kursdetails
โข Introduction to AI-Optimized Desalination Techniques: Overview of desalination methods, AI applications in desalination, and the importance of AI-optimized desalination techniques.
โข Fundamentals of Artificial Intelligence: Basics of AI, machine learning, and deep learning, focusing on their applications in desalination processes.
โข Data Analysis for Desalination: Data collection, processing, and analysis techniques for AI-optimized desalination systems.
โข AI-Driven Desalination Plant Design: Utilizing AI for designing, retrofitting, and maintaining desalination plants, emphasizing cost-effectiveness and energy efficiency.
โข Optimization of Desalination Processes Using AI: AI-based techniques for optimizing desalination plant performance, energy consumption, and water quality.
โข Machine Learning Algorithms in Desalination: Application of supervised, unsupervised, and reinforcement learning algorithms for monitoring, predicting, and controlling desalination processes.
โข AI-Driven Predictive Maintenance in Desalination Plants: Predictive maintenance strategies using AI, focusing on reducing downtime, maintenance costs, and improving overall plant performance.
โข AI for Water Management and Distribution: AI-based decision-making tools for water management and distribution, addressing issues like water scarcity, demand forecasting, and resource allocation.
โข Sustainability and Environmental Impact of AI-Optimized Desalination Techniques: Examining the ecological impact of AI-enhanced desalination methods and sustainable practices.
โข Ethical Considerations and Future Perspectives in AI-Optimized Desalination Techniques: Investigating ethical considerations, potential challenges, and future trends in AI-driven desalination technology.
